In recent years, the field of healthcare has seen a rapid evolution with the integration of artificial intelligence (AI) technology. One country that has been at the forefront of this revolution is Slovenia. medical AI in Slovenia has been making significant strides in improving healthcare delivery, diagnosis, treatment, and patient outcomes. One of the key areas where AI has made a profound impact is in medical diagnostics. Through advanced machine learning algorithms, AI systems are able to analyze vast amounts of medical data to assist healthcare professionals in making accurate and timely diagnoses. In Slovenia, medical AI tools have been developed to aid in the early detection of diseases such as cancer, heart conditions, and neurological disorders, leading to improved patient outcomes and survival rates. AI-powered telemedicine platforms have also been implemented in Slovenia, allowing patients to access healthcare services remotely. This has been especially crucial during the COVID-19 pandemic, as it has enabled individuals to consult with healthcare providers and receive necessary medical advice without having to physically visit a healthcare facility. Medical AI in Slovenia has also played a significant role in personalized medicine. By analyzing an individual's genetic makeup and medical history, AI systems can assist in predicting how a patient may respond to certain treatments, allowing for more tailored and effective healthcare interventions. Furthermore, AI has been utilized in healthcare management systems in Slovenia to optimize hospital operations, streamline administrative tasks, and improve patient care coordination. By automating repetitive tasks and providing real-time analytics, AI has helped healthcare facilities in Slovenia operate more efficiently, reduce costs, and enhance the overall patient experience. While the integration of AI in healthcare has shown immense promise in Slovenia, it is essential to address ethical considerations, data privacy concerns, and the need for ongoing physician training to ensure the responsible and effective use of AI technology in medical practice. In conclusion, medical AI in Slovenia is revolutionizing healthcare by improving diagnostics, enabling remote care delivery, advancing personalized medicine, and optimizing healthcare management systems. As AI technology continues to evolve, it is poised to further enhance the quality of healthcare services and outcomes for patients in Slovenia and beyond.
